Add some missing getter functions to the lua API

ObjectRef:
get_properties
get_armor_groups
get_animation
get_attach
get_bone_position

Players:
get_physics_override
hud_get_hotbar_itemcount
hud_get_hotbar_image
hud_get_hotbar_selected_image
get_sky
get_day_night_ratio
get_local_animation
get_eye_offset

Global:
minetest.get_gen_notify
minetest.get_noiseparams
